Double Glazing Maintenance: Ensuring Longevity and Efficiency
Double glazing has actually become a popular option for house owners looking for enhanced energy efficiency, noise decrease, and improved security. This specialized window function consists of 2 panes of glass with an area in between them, which is often filled with argon or another inert gas to decrease heat transfer. While double glazing offers numerous benefits, it requires proper maintenance to ensure it carries out efficiently and lasts for several years. This short article dives into practical tips for maintaining double-glazed windows, highlights typical issues, and answers frequently asked concerns.

Typical Issues with Double Glazing
Like any home feature, double-glazed windows can establish issues in time. Typical issues consist of:
- Condensation: The development of moisture in between the panes might suggest a seal failure.
- Draughts: Weakened seals can cause air leaks, reducing energy efficiency.
- Misalignment: Poor positioning of windows can affect opening and closing operations.
- Dirt and Grime Accumulation: Dirt accumulation on frames and tracks can hinder window performance and appearance.
Double Glazing Maintenance Tips

Routine Cleaning
- Glass Cleaning: Use a soft cloth or sponge with a mixture of moderate detergent and water to clean up the glass. Prevent abrasive products that can scratch the surface area.
- Frame Cleaning: The frames can be washed utilizing warm soapy water. Make certain to utilize a non-abrasive cloth.
Examine Seals
- Examine for Damage: Regularly check seals around the windows for wear and tear. Any noticeable cracks could cause air leaks or wetness intrusion.
- Space Inspection: Ensure there are no gaps in between the frame and the wall. If present, reseal with caulk or weather removing.
Treat the Hinges
- Lubrication: Regularly lubricate the hinges and locks to guarantee smooth operation. Utilize a silicone spray or a dedicated lube.
- Tightening up Screws: Check for loose screws and tighten them as required.
Deal with Adjustments
- Positioning Check: Ensure the window opens, closes, and locks effectively. If not, alignment might need adjusting.
- Professional Help: If misalignment continues, consider working with a professional to rectify the issue.
Monitor for Condensation
- Internal Condensation: If condensation kinds inside the window panes, it may suggest a failure of the seal; think about getting in touch with an expert to replace the unit.
- External Condensation: This can take place even with effectively functioning double glazing, typically associated to humidity levels inside the home.
Seasonal Maintenance
- Spring/Fall Maintenance: Conduct an extensive evaluation during the change of seasons. Clean frames and checks for any damage in the changing weather conditions.
- Winter season Preparations: Ensure windows are sealed properly to avoid draughts throughout cooler months.
Table of Maintenance Schedule
| Upkeep Task | Frequency | Approach |
|---|---|---|
| Clean glass and frames | Every 3 months | Soft fabric, moderate detergent |
| Inspect seals | Every 6 months | Visual inspection |
| Oil hinges and locks | Every 6 months | Silicone spray |
| Inspect alignment | Every year | Operational check |
| Expert assessment | Every 2 years | Licensed service technician |
